Fiber Power
Researchers from APL have established new, scalable methods of developing battery- and solar-powered fibers, making it theoretically possible to harvest and store electrical energy right from the clothing people wear. These fibers could power high-performance wearable electronics that breathe, stretch, and wash just like conventional textiles.

AI Helps Develop Novel Superconductor
A multidisciplinary team at APL has discovered a novel superconductor using artificial intelligence. The key to this breakthrough came through combining materials science expertise and real data into a predictive AI model, which vastly accelerates the timeline of targeted materials discovery.
